Hmm. It's showing Chevron syntax instead of verbose.
Try opening all the applications that are called by your script.
Select and copy your script, Quit the Script Editor and relaunch the Editor.
Create a new doc and paste in.
See if that helps.

> I am testing an application with some scripts I wrote on Leopard.
> On Snow Leopard my application's sdef is not seen by AppleScript Editor.
> For example "make new project" is replaced on opening by "make new «class Proj"»" which compiles but doesn't run.
> I can open the dictionary with shift-cmd-O.
> The application file is located on the Leopard startup disk.
>
> What am I doing wrong?
> Using Script Editor instead on Snow Leopard makes no difference.
